Skylar Diggins-Smith is now also an Emmy winner

A standout athlete from both South Bend Washington High School and Notre Dame is now also an Emmy winner.

One of Michiana’s favorite daughters, Skylar Diggins-Smith, has had a great career in the WNBA, where the Tulsa Shock selected her 3rd overall. She moved with the team to Dallas a few years later and is now a member of the Phoenix Mercury.

But she’s also stepping into a new role as a broadcaster for the Phoenix Suns. Now she’s won an Emmy for her broadcasting. For the record, she’s one-quarter of the way to winning an EGOT, and it’s hard to think of anyone with that honor who was also the Nancy Lieberman Point Guard of the Year.
